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
368489414 614 97423759 05 513
44581721492 123
44581721492 123
0387 519079 1645700759
All about undefined
Interested in learning more?
44581721492 123
0387 519079 1645700759
See more
155436267 95
60 39374064 0383652404 2192 82910595
See more
097 09558166646
9639 449 31275844
See more